Headrests, how do I recover them?
My headrests are in bad shape. Unfortunately my seat cover kit didn't include anything to refurbish the headrests. Do these need to be provessionally done? Mine look like they have been recovered with viynl, and the covering job looks like it turned out ok, but they were stapled in on the bottom, is that correct? I thought they were supposed to be stitched. I'm not sure what the foam looks like underneath them. $100 bucks per side seems a little steep to have them done and I'd like to do them myself if at all possible.
Any idears?

Re: Headrests, how do I recover them? (Steve Straus)
Steve,
The original (1969) ones were molded with no seams. Never seen a repair or replacement kit. When at the swap meets I am always on the lookout for old ones in good shape. Keep “up-grading” the ones I have plus a spare.
George

Re: Headrests, how do I recover them? (Steve Straus)
Had CORVETTE AMERICA do mine last spring. Had them done original ABS. SEAMS on the sides are not original. they list 68-69 as the same. the bottoms are glued not stapled.the ABS covers are 65 a pair and the foam is 49 for the pair. that works out to 115. They will do it for you for 129. for $15 I just let them do it, I think I had to send $14 for shipping. They came back in about two weeks looking excellant. i don`t know how you would glue the bottoms to get the curves right. Jon
